As part of the Marrowfield migration, all legacy cron jobs are being moved onto the Quillrunner workflow engine. Each job becomes a declared workflow with explicit retry policy, timeout, and ownership metadata, replacing the untracked crontab entries on the old scheduler hosts. Contractors should register new workflows through the internal Quillrunner API rather than editing crontabs directly. Registration calls must authenticate with the internal key provided below.

service key, tadup-tahog: zpat7_wB1tnEL

# Break-Glass: Catalog Cache Invalidation

Scope: the Pinrow product catalog at Veldstone Retail. If stale prices persist after a purge and the Hollowmere invalidation queue is wedged, use break-glass to flush the edge tier directly. Contractors: get verbal sign-off from the catalog lead first. Steps: open the Hollowmere admin shell, select emergency-flush, confirm the tenant, and run it once — repeated flushes thrash the origin. Access is logged and expires after 20 minutes. Unseal the admin shell with the passphrase below.

recovery phrase for kahop-tajog: istix-casvan

Ticket #— Floor 9 Opening Prep, Brindlemoor House

Hi facilities folks, Floor 9 opens to staff next Monday and we need a few things squared away before then. Lift access is live, but the two side doors by the kitchenette are still on the old lock config — please reprogram them before Friday. Also, signage for the quiet rooms hasn't arrived, so pop up the temporary printed ones for now. Until the badge readers sync, the interim door code for Floor 9 is below.

door code, bajop-bajog: bdg-DSWAC-43621

// CATALOG_CACHE_TTL_SECONDS
// Controls eviction for the Merchline product catalog cache.
// Do not raise above 300: the pricing sync assumes stale
// entries die within five minutes, and the invalidation
// webhook is best-effort only. If you change this, also
// bump the cache key version constant two lines down, or
// mixed-format entries will survive deploys. Validated
// against the build identified by the token below.

pipeline stamp: htk9_ce63042d9